1,235 SVGCC Students to Receive Laptops from the Government

One thousand, two hundred and thirty-five (1,235) first-year students of the St Vincent & the Grenadines Community College (SVGCC) will receive laptops from the Government of St Vincent & the Grenadines this Thursday and Friday, 2–3 October 2025.

The distribution of the ASUS laptops will take place over two official ceremonies.

The first ceremony will be held at the Villa Campus on Thursday, 2 October 2025 at 2:00 p.m., during which students from the Division of Arts, Sciences and General Studies will receive 573 laptops and the Division of Teacher Education  will receive 26 laptops — a total of 599 laptops on that day.

The second ceremony will take place at the Arnos Vale Campus on Friday, 3 October 2025 at 10:00 a.m., at which students from the Division of Technical and Vocational Education will receive 605 laptops, and those in the Division of Nursing Education will receive 31 laptops —  a total of 636 laptops.

The feature speaker at both ceremonies will be the Prime Minister, Dr Ralph E. Gonsalves. On Thursday, 2 October, Camillo Gonsalves, Minister of Finance, will deliver brief remarks, while on Friday, 3 October, Curtis King, Minister of Education and National Reconciliation, will address the gathering.

The information was sourced from a press release by the Agency for Public Information.
